3K1L
Crystal Structure of FANCL
X-RAY DIFFRACTION
Crystallization
Crystalization Experiments | ||||
---|---|---|---|---|
ID | Method | pH | Temperature | Details |
1 | VAPOR DIFFUSION, HANGING DROP | 8 | 277 | 1M Ammonium Citrate, 100mM Bis-Tris-Propane, 1mM TCEP, 0.050mM ZNCl2, pH 8, VAPOR DIFFUSION, HANGING DROP, temperature 277K |
Crystal Properties | |
---|---|
Matthews coefficient | Solvent content |
5.07399 | 75.7587 |
Crystal Data
Unit Cell | |
---|---|
Length ( Å ) | Angle ( ˚ ) |
a = 188.68 | α = 90 |
b = 188.68 | β = 90 |
c = 259.36 | γ = 120 |
Symmetry | |
---|---|
Space Group | H 3 2 |
